Day 1: London
On arrival in London transfer independently to your hotel for check-in, and pick up your Welcome Pack containing all your tickets and travel vouchers. Then join a hop-on/hop-off sightseeing tour on board the famous red London double-decker buses followed by a Thames river cruise & a guided walking tour. Return to your hotel for your overnight stay.
Day 2 London | Bath
Following breakfast at your hotel make your way to the railway station and take the fast train (90 mins) into the west of England to the European Heritage City of Bath, a city dating back to Roman times and now a fine city full of 18th-century classic architecture, boutiques, and antique and craft shops. Join the afternoon small group guided tour through the beautiful Cotswolds countryside to the World Heritage Site of Stonehenge, to wonder at this prehistoric monument, before returning via Lacock village, which is a popular film location featured in Pride & Prejudice and the Harry Potter films. Stay overnight at your Bath city centre hotel. (B)
Day 3: Bath | Liverpool
This morning catch the train (2.5 hours) to the vibrant maritime city of Liverpool, home of The Beatles and departure point for so many emigrants seeking a new life and fortune in the New World. After checking in to your hotel, join the Magic Mystery Tour of Liverpool to take an atmospheric journey into the life and landmarks of The Fab Four. Follow this with a visit to the award-winning Beatles Story to see how the four young lads from Liverpool were propelled to the dizzy heights of worldwide fame and fortune to become the greatest band of all time. Finish off the day with an evening at the famous Cavern Club. Return to your Liverpool hotel. (B)
Day 4: Liverpool | Windermere
Leave Liverpool and take the train for the 2 1/2 hour journey to Windermere in the stunning Lake District. Check in to your hotel and then enjoy free time exploring this quaint Lake District town where you can dip a toe into England's largest lake, or enjoy a short lake cruise. Return to your hotel in Windermere for your overnight stay. (B)
Day 5: Lakes
Today immerse yourself in the Complete Beatrix Potter's Lakeland & Wordsworth Tour, a whole day of exploration with detailed commentary of the many places associated with Beatrix Potter's life and characters, including Hill Top, Hawkshead, Wray Castle, Tarn Hows, Newlands Valley, Derwentwater and Keswick. There is also a visit to Wordsworth's home, Dove Cottage, at Grasmere, along with a lake cruise on Derwentwater and a visit to Castlerigg Stone Circle. Return to your hotel in Windermere for your overnight stay. (B)
Day 6: Windermere | Glasgow
After breakfast check out and make your way to the railway station to take the train (3 hours) through the border countryside and mountains to Glasgow. Check into your hotel and spend the afternoon at leisure exploring Glasgow on your own. Overnight accommodation. (B)
Day 7: Highlands
Make an early start today to join an award-winning small group Scottish Highlands tour to see and experience some of the most dramatic scenery on offer in the area, including Glencoe, one of Scotland's most famous glens; Fort William, Ben Nevis, Britain's highest mountain; and Loch Ness, where you may even be lucky enough
to catch a glimpse of the elusive monster. Return to your Glasgow hotel for your overnight stay. (B)
Day 8: Edinburgh
After breakfast take the short train journey (1 hour)to Edinburgh for a day of sightseeing in the Scottish capital with a hop-on/hop-off tour and a visit to Edinburgh Castle. After visiting this beautiful city, return to Glasgow for overnight accommodation. (B)
Day 9: Depart Glasgow
Today marks the end of your journey. Check-out of out of your hotel and take the train back to London and home.(B)
